Why NDIS Audit Readiness Matters

Many providers underestimate how detailed an NDIS audit can be. Auditors may review your policies, procedures, operational systems, staff records, risk documents, participant files and evidence of how your organisation manages quality and safety.

Common Issues Providers Face Before Audit

A lot of providers think they are ready until they begin checking the details closely. In reality, common issues often include outdated policies, incomplete worker files, missing evidence of operational practice, weak incident and complaints procedures, and unclear risk documentation.

Missing Evidence

Providers may have policies in place but not enough evidence to show those policies are being used in daily operations.

Weak Registers

Incident, complaints, risk and continuous improvement registers may be missing, incomplete or not properly maintained.

Incomplete Staff Files

Staff files may be missing qualifications, screening checks, induction records, position descriptions or training evidence.

Do I need audit preparation if I already have policies?

Yes, because audit readiness is not only about having policies. You also need evidence that your systems are being implemented, including registers, staff files, participant documents and risk records.
